Five features of a dependable impact door in Miami are reinforced aluminum or fiberglass frame construction rated for 50+ PSF design pressure, laminated glass with 0.090-inch PVB interlayers surviving debris impacts, Miami-Dade Notice of Acceptance certification, multi-point locking systems with commercial-grade hardware, and energy-efficient Low-E coatings achieving U-Factor ratings below 0.40. The Federal Alliance for Safe Homes reports dependable impact doors prevent 60% of wind-driven water intrusion and interior pressurization that causes catastrophic structural failures during hurricanes. These critical features distinguish certified protection systems from standard residential doors failing at wind speeds of 90-110 mph.

Miami's High Velocity Hurricane Zone designation requires the strictest impact door standards in the United States. Hurricane Andrew's 165 mph winds in 1992 destroyed 25,000+ homes with 80% of failures originating at door openings lacking adequate protection. The Miami-Dade County Product Control Division established comprehensive testing protocols ensuring products withstand Category 5 hurricane conditions. How Do You Tell If a Door Is Impact-Rated in Florida?

You tell if a door is impact-rated in Florida by locating the permanent product label displaying Miami-Dade County Notice of Acceptance number, design pressure rating, manufacturer information, and installation date on the door frame or panel edge. The American Architectural Manufacturers Association requires these labels remain legible and attached throughout product lifespan providing inspection verification and warranty documentation. Building officials verify NOA labels during final inspections confirming code compliance while insurance carriers request certification documentation for premium discounts.

Product Label Requirements

Impact-rated doors display permanent labels etched, embossed, or applied with durable adhesives resisting UV degradation and weather exposure. The labels include NOA number formatted as "NOA XX-XXXX.XX" identifying specific product approval. Design pressure ratings appear as positive and negative PSF values indicating wind resistance capacity. Manufacturer name, product model, and installation date complete required information.

Label placement varies by manufacturer with most positioning labels on door frame header jambs or hinge-side jambs. Sliding glass doors often place labels on fixed panel corners or bottom rails. French doors display labels on active panel meeting stiles. The Window & Door Manufacturers Association recommends accessible locations allowing verification without door removal.

Missing or damaged labels create inspection failures and insurance complications. Contact manufacturers for replacement labels providing original purchase documentation and NOA numbers. Many manufacturers maintain databases linking installation addresses to product specifications supporting label replacement requests. Digital documentation including photos and NOA certificates supplement physical labels during verification processes.

NOA Verification Process

Verify NOA numbers through Miami-Dade County Product Control Division online database at miamidade.gov/building. Search by NOA number, manufacturer name, or product description confirming current approval status. The database provides testing reports, approved installation instructions, and product specifications. Check approval expiration dates as some older NOA numbers lose validity requiring product updates or replacements.

Expired or revoked NOA certifications require product replacement during permit processes and insurance underwriting reviews. The Product Control Division updates approval status when manufacturers discontinue products, fail recertification testing, or request withdrawal. Properties with de-listed products face code compliance issues affecting property sales and insurance coverage.

Request manufacturer certification letters documenting NOA approval, testing standards compliance, and installation specifications. These letters support insurance discount applications, property appraisals, and building permit submissions. Keep documentation with property records protecting investment value and ensuring future verification capability.

Physical Inspection Indicators

Impact-rated doors weigh 2-3 times more than standard doors due to laminated glass and reinforced construction. A 3x8 foot entry door weighing 200-250 pounds likely contains impact-rated components while 75-100 pound doors use standard construction. The substantial weight indicates quality materials and proper engineering meeting certification requirements.

Laminated glass shows visible interlayer bonding when viewing edge profiles. The PVB interlayer appears as thin plastic film between glass sheets distinguishing impact construction from standard tempered or annealed glass. Frame members measure 0.125-0.187 inches thick compared to 0.062-0.090 inches for standard residential doors. This increased material thickness provides structural capacity resisting design pressure loads.

Multi-point locking mechanisms with 3-5 locking points indicate impact-rated construction. These commercial-grade systems exceed single-point locksets on standard doors. Heavy-duty hinges using ball bearings and stainless steel construction support impact door weights while ensuring smooth operation. The hardware quality provides visual confirmation of proper impact-rated components.

Installation Documentation

Building permits for impact door installation include NOA numbers, product specifications, and approved installation methods. Permit files remain permanently accessible through county building departments. Request permit copies from current or previous property owners documenting installation compliance. These records prove essential during property sales, insurance applications, and renovation planning.

Final inspection reports confirm building officials verified product labels, proper installation, and code compliance. Approved inspection documentation validates warranty coverage and insurance eligibility. Some jurisdictions provide online permit record access through property appraiser websites. Search by property address retrieving permit history including impact door installations.

Manufacturer warranties require installation by licensed contractors following approved methods. Warranty registration cards or online registration confirmations document proper installation and activate coverage. Keep warranty paperwork with property records ensuring future claim capability. Transferable warranties maintain value for subsequent homeowners increasing property marketability.

Are Impact-Resistant Doors Required in Florida?

Yes, impact-resistant doors or approved opening protection systems are required in Florida Wind-Borne Debris Regions defined as areas within one mile of coastal mean high water where basic wind speed equals or exceeds 130 mph per Florida Building Code Section 1609.1.2. Miami-Dade County falls entirely within High Velocity Hurricane Zone requiring the strictest standards. All new construction, additions exceeding 50% of building value, and door replacements must include certified impact doors or approved shutter systems meeting code requirements.

Miami-Dade County HVHZ Requirements

High Velocity Hurricane Zone encompasses all of Miami-Dade County and portions of Broward County requiring Miami-Dade NOA certification for all fenestration products. The designation originated after Hurricane Andrew demonstrated catastrophic failures in standard construction. Design wind speeds of 170-180 mph ultimate velocity apply throughout the zone creating most stringent requirements nationwide.

Large missile impact testing requires doors survive 9-pound 2x4 lumber projectiles traveling at 50 feet per second. Two impacts at different locations must not create openings exceeding 3 square inches. Subsequent cyclic pressure testing applies 9,000 positive and negative pressure cycles at 1.5 times design pressure. Products maintaining weathertight integrity throughout testing receive NOA certification.

Building permits verify product NOA numbers against approved databases before issuance. Inspectors confirm permanent labels on installed doors matching permit documentation. Violations require product removal and replacement with certified systems. The strict enforcement protects property values, maintains insurance eligibility, and ensures public safety.

Statewide Wind-Borne Debris Regions

Florida Building Code designates Wind-Borne Debris Regions covering Broward, Palm Beach, Monroe, Lee, Collier, Martin, St. Lucie, Indian River, Brevard, Volusia, Flagler, St. Johns, Duval, Nassau, Charlotte, Sarasota, Manatee, Pinellas, Hillsborough, and portions of 10+ additional counties. Properties within these regions require impact-resistant doors or approved protection systems for all exterior openings.

The one-mile coastal distance threshold captures most vulnerable areas experiencing extreme wind speeds and debris fields. Properties beyond this distance in 140+ mph wind zones still require protection but may use alternative systems meeting lower testing standards. Local building officials determine specific requirements based on property locations and wind speed maps published by American Society of Civil Engineers.

Existing homes built before 2001 code adoption face no mandatory retrofit requirements unless renovations exceed 50% of building value. However, insurance carriers increasingly require impact doors for policy renewals in coastal areas creating practical mandates beyond legal requirements. Many homeowners install impact doors voluntarily protecting property and qualifying for insurance discounts.

Compliance Alternatives

Storm shutters provide code-compliant alternatives to impact doors when properly certified and installed. Roll-down shutters, accordion shutters, Bahama shutters, colonial shutters, and panel systems must meet identical impact testing and design pressure standards as impact doors. These systems cost 40-60% less than door replacement but require deployment before each storm and provide no year-round benefits.

Aluminum or polycarbonate panels attach to permanent tracks providing temporary protection. Panels cost $8-15 per square foot installed representing most economical code-compliant option. However, installation time requirements of 30-60 minutes per opening and storage space needs create practical limitations. Elderly homeowners or those with physical limitations struggle with panel systems during emergency preparations.

Fabric storm screens use engineered textiles achieving impact ratings while maintaining visibility during storms. These newer systems cost $12-18 per square foot installed with simpler deployment than traditional shutters. Limited manufacturer availability and relatively short track record restrict widespread adoption despite potential advantages. Most homeowners prefer permanent impact door solutions eliminating pre-storm preparation requirements.

What Frame Materials Work Best for Impact Doors?

Reinforced aluminum frames work best for impact doors in South Florida because they resist salt air corrosion, achieve Design Pressure ratings of 60-70 PSF, maintain dimensional stability in humidity and temperature cycling, and cost 15-25% less than comparable fiberglass systems. The American Architectural Manufacturers Association rates marine-grade aluminum as optimal material for coastal impact door applications lasting 25-30 years with minimal maintenance. Thermally broken aluminum frames provide superior energy efficiency while vinyl and fiberglass options suit specific applications requiring different characteristics.

Aluminum Frame Advantages

Marine-grade aluminum extrusions use 6063-T5 alloy composition providing optimal strength-to-weight ratios. The material resists corrosion in salt air environments through protective oxide layer formation and factory-applied powder coating finishes. These finishes maintain color stability for 15-20 years without fading or chalking common in coastal installations.

Wall thicknesses of 0.125-0.187 inches provide structural capacity resisting design pressure loads without excessive deflection. Internal reinforcement channels accept structural fasteners at 6-8 inch spacing distributing wind loads to building structure. The engineered construction achieves 50-70 PSF design pressure ratings exceeding Florida Building Code requirements by 10-20 PSF providing safety margins.

Thermal break technology inserts polyurethane or polyamide barriers between interior and exterior aluminum sections preventing heat conduction. These breaks reduce frame U-Factors from 1.0-1.2 for standard aluminum to 0.35-0.45 for broken designs. The improved energy efficiency qualifies products for Energy Star certification and utility rebate programs.

Fiberglass Door Construction

High-density fiberglass construction provides superior impact resistance through solid core design without hollow sections weakening structure. The material resists warping, rotting, and deterioration in humid environments unlike wood alternatives. Fiberglass accepts wood grain textures and stain finishes mimicking luxury wood appearance at 40-50% lower cost.

Polyurethane foam cores add strength and insulation achieving U-Factor ratings of 0.35-0.45. The foam expands during manufacturing filling cavities and bonding to fiberglass skins creating monolithic assemblies. This construction provides excellent sound dampening reducing exterior noise transmission by 40-50% compared to hollow metal doors.

Fiberglass impact doors cost $2,500-4,500 installed including frames and hardware. Premium manufacturers including Therma-Tru and Plastpro provide comprehensive warranties covering materials and finishes. The products suit traditional architectural styles where wood appearance provides aesthetic advantages over contemporary aluminum systems.

Vinyl Frame Applications

Vinyl frames achieve excellent energy efficiency through multi-chamber construction trapping air within hollow cavities. The material requires no painting or refinishing maintaining appearance throughout 25-30 year lifespans. Fusion-welded corners eliminate mechanical fasteners creating weathertight joints without thermal bridges.

Internal aluminum or steel reinforcement provides structural capacity meeting design pressure requirements. Without reinforcement, vinyl lacks strength for large openings or high wind zones. Quality manufacturers engineer specific reinforcement placement achieving certification while maximizing vinyl's insulation benefits.

Vinyl impact doors suit contemporary architectural styles accepting smooth finishes in white, tan, or gray colors. Custom color options add 15-20% to base costs. The material proves most popular for new construction where builders balance cost and performance. Retrofit applications often prefer aluminum matching existing window frames for architectural consistency.

What Glass Packages Provide Maximum Protection?

Laminated glass packages using two 4mm tempered glass sheets bonded to 0.090-inch PVB interlayers provide maximum impact door protection surviving multiple debris strikes and maintaining integrity through Category 5 hurricanes. The Insurance Institute for Business & Home Safety rates this heavy-duty construction as highest protection level available for residential applications. Adding Low-E coatings and argon gas fills creates insulated laminated glass units combining hurricane protection with superior energy efficiency achieving U-Factors of 0.30-0.35 and SHGC values of 0.25-0.30.

Standard Laminated Construction

Two sheets of 3mm tempered glass bonded to 0.060-inch PVB interlayers meet minimum Miami-Dade certification requirements for most residential applications. This construction passes large missile testing and cyclic pressure protocols while maintaining reasonable costs. The glass package adds 80-100 pounds to standard door weights requiring reinforced frames and commercial-grade hardware.

Tempered glass undergoes heat treatment reaching 1,200°F then rapid cooling creating surface compression of 10,000+ PSI. This process increases strength 4-5 times compared to annealed glass. When impact cracks tempered glass, the PVB interlayer holds fragments preventing dangerous projectiles and maintaining weathertight barrier.

Standard laminated packages cost $600-900 per door opening for typical residential sizes. This represents baseline pricing for Miami-Dade certified products. The construction provides adequate protection for properties under 40 feet height in standard exposure conditions. Coastal properties or high-rise applications benefit from enhanced packages.

Heavy-Duty Enhanced Packages

Thicker 4mm glass sheets paired with 0.090-inch PVB interlayers create heavy-duty packages for extreme exposure conditions. This construction survives multiple impacts at identical locations exceeding certification requirements. The enhanced protection suits beachfront properties, high-rise buildings, and areas with extreme wind exposure.

Design pressure ratings increase 15-20% compared to standard packages allowing larger door sizes in high wind zones. The structural capacity prevents flexing and stress concentration during sustained hurricane winds. Insurance carriers recognize enhanced packages providing maximum premium discounts for properties in Wind-Borne Debris Regions.

Heavy-duty packages add 30-40% to material costs reaching $800-1,200 per door opening installed. The investment provides peace of mind and maximum protection margins. Properties with exposure to open water, limited windbreaks, or upper-floor locations justify enhanced specifications.

Energy-Efficient Insulated Units

Insulated laminated glass combines impact-resistant exterior panes with standard interior panes creating dual-pane assemblies. Low-E coatings on interior glass surfaces block 70-85% of infrared radiation while allowing 60-70% visible light transmission. Argon gas fills between panes reduce heat transfer by 20-30% compared to air-filled units.

U-Factor ratings of 0.30-0.35 and SHGC values of 0.25-0.30 qualify products for Energy Star certification in Florida climate zones. The improved thermal performance reduces cooling costs by 20-25% compared to standard single-pane laminated construction. Annual energy savings of $150-300 per door offset higher initial costs within 8-12 years.

Insulated laminated packages cost 30-40% more than standard construction reaching $900-1,400 per door installed. The premium pricing delivers maximum protection combined with superior energy efficiency. These packages suit homeowners prioritizing comprehensive performance over initial cost savings.
